Sheila Terese Nelson of Independence, Oregon moved on to the great garden in the sky to join loved ones who have gone before.
Sheila was preceded in death by her parents Edward and Charlotte Curran; daughter Tamara Nelson; grandson, Michael Nelson-Cedillo and long-time companion, Joseph Quinn. She is survived by her daughter Pamela (Nelson) Young, son Randall Nelson, grandchildren Danielle and James Young and great-grandchildren Jax Nelson-Cedillo, Pheobe Winborn and Frank Winborn IV.
Born in New York, Sheila spent most of her youth in Albuquerque, New Mexico. Her family relocated to Salem, Oregon in 1956 where she attended and graduated from Sacred Heart Academy, later attending WOU and OSU. Sheila retired after 27 wonderful years as an instructional assistant from the Central School District in 2001 – and reveled in her retirement.
Sheila loved her family and friends, gardening and traveling the world via the internet. Sheila had a personal relationship with God and often said “I believe in angels.” Sheila was the matriarch of our family, deeply loved by many and will be dearly missed.
